Robert Yothers Obituary

Robert Andrew "Bob" Yothers, 83, of Mt. Pleasant, passed away Sunday, Jan. 12, 2014, at the Excela Health Latrobe Hospital. Bob was born Jan. 13, 1930, in Mt. Pleasant, the son of the late Andrew and Clara Eva Weaver Yothers, who died in 1954 and 1989. Bob was employed for US Steel Corp., Edgar Thompson Works, Braddock, retiring in 1992 with 44 years of service. He was a member of the American Legion Post 446, Slovak, Firemen's and Falcons Clubs of Mt. Pleasant, was an avid bowler and former member of several leagues in the area and a former member of the Army Reserve, Connellsville Unit. Surviving are his wife of 59 years, Dee Riggar Yothers; children, Robert K. Yothers and wife, Marion, of Acme, and Kathy Yothers Petrarca and husband, Chris, of Scottdale; grandchildren, Nicole Seese and husband, Bob, and John Petrarca; special great-grandchildren, Jacob and Halle Seese; and several nieces and nephews. In addition to his parents, Bob was preceded in death by a sister, Doris Klepsky, Nov. 5, 2001; and an infant brother.
